Applications open for Legrand Empowering Scholarship Program 2023-24

Hyderabad & Assam, August 08, 2023: Group Legrand India, the leading provider of electrical and digital building infrastructure and a leading name in empowering lives and lighting up millions of Indian homes is delighted to announce the application process for ‘Legrand Empowering Scholarship Program’ for the new batch of 2023-24. The scholarship encourages applications from deserving girl students, differently abled students, and transgender students from across India.

Being a socially responsible organization certified by GEEIS (International Certificate for D&I Commitment), gender equality has remained a prominent area of action. The “Legrand Empowering Scholarship” was established in 2018 to actively support educational initiatives that empower girls.

Since its inception, the program has supported more than 400+ girls students pursuing Engineering, Architecture, Science, Technology, Finance, and other related fields from recognized colleges and universities across India, including differently abled and transgender students.

In addition to providing financial support for education, Legrand initiated the Student Mentorship Program in 2022. This program is designed to nurture future women leaders by offering holistic development through mentoring, building confidence, providing life skills, soft skills, and career guidance. Over 50 beneficiaries of the Legrand Scholarship have completed their mentorship programs, and fresh batches are welcomed annually.

Legrand partners with Buddy4Study, a reputed organization, to facilitate the application and selection process for the scholarship program. Interested students can enroll through the Buddy4Study portal.

For 2023-24, the Legrand Empowering Scholarship Program aims to support 100 scholars. The scholarship benefit will continue until the successful completion of the students’ academic program, based on their performance.
